Do I need a passport to travel to Puerto Rico?
Nope! Just your REAL ID.

What will the weather be like this time of year?
San Juan in late March is warm and breezy, with highs in the 80s and evenings in the 70s. You can expect plenty of sunshine, some humidity, and the occasional quick shower. Itâs a beautiful time for beach days and exploring, so pack light, breathable clothes!
